Default Saturday CFB "Best Bet"

South Carolina –6.5 (-7.0) over North Carolina
Both teams have played close to the same schedule strength this year so far. Against the schedule South Carolina is outscoring their opponents by 8 point per game while N. Carolina is minus 7 points per game to their opponents. N. Carolina is 2-4 coming into this game and S. Carolina is 5-1 SU and 4-1 against the spread. N. Carolina could be in a “let down situation” coming off their upset win over Miami Florida last week. They could also be looking ahead to Wake Forest next week, while S. Carolina has Vanderbilt nest week, a team they historically handle easily. S. Carolina played within 12 points of powerhouse LSU and beat the high powered offense of Kentucky by 15 points last week. They have two spread wins on the road this year, 16-12 at Georgia as a 4 point dog and 16-28 at LSU as a 17.5 point dog. They are 5-2 as a road favorite in the past 7 situations. South Carolina has an extra 2 days rest this week as their last game was on 10/4 while NC played on 10/6…This was one of our “early beat the line move” plays at –6.5…Some books have moved it to 7 so you might want to consider buying the ½ if you wish…..
South Carolina by 18.0
